LOW END is a free music venue inside Bemis Center for Contemporary Arts. Shows feature sound artists, composers, and experimental musicians from Omaha, across the country, and around the world — all free to attend. The programming ranges from field recording and electronic composition to experimental jazz, prepared piano, and genre-spanning performance. Confirmed 2026 shows: Mauricio López F (March 5), a Volumes performance by Phill Smith (March 28), and Riley Mulherkar (April 16). The room is small and the listening is genuine — not background music.
